While Matlock train station doesn't boast an array of facilities, it offers critical services necessary for a smooth travel experience. You won't find a ticket office here, but there are ticket machines for collecting tickets purchased online. These machines are accessible for passengers with mobility impairments, and there's even a smartcard validator to streamline journeys.
Accessibility is a prime concern, and Matlock accommodates with step-free access to the platform; however, the station falls under Category B, indicating some areas may pose a challenge for those with significant mobility issues. While there's a seating area on the platform, there’s no waiting room or refreshment facilities, so it might be wise to bring any essentials with you. Despite the limitations, the station is covered by CCTV, ensuring safety is prioritized.
The station offers a few vital links for onwards travel. Although there's no dedicated taxi rank, taxis are available for pick-up and drop-off which can provide convenient service to your next destination or accommodation. Plus, the bus interchange allows for seamless integration with local transport services, making it effortless to explore the surrounding areas or return at your convenience. Though smaller in scale, Upholland Train Station provides essential facilities to cater to travelers' needs. Ticket machines are available, allowing passengers to collect tickets purchased online - a necessary convenience given the absence of a staffed ticket office. The station offers induction loops, but it falls short on other amenities such as refreshments and waiting rooms. It also does not provide accessible ticket machines, highlighting a need for improvement in disability access.
For those seeking assistance, staff support can be accessed through the helpline 08002006060, especially when the station is unstaffed. Keeping safety in mind, note that there is no CCTV surveillance and no customer help points at the station, so travelers should stay vigilant with their belongings.
Upholland's connectivity transcends the tracks, extending to multiple modes of transport that allow travelers to continue their journey with ease. Taxis can be reserved using services such as Cab4You, providing a hassle-free transition from train to car. Local bus services are readily available, although a rail replacement service may occasionally necessitate bus travel from Pimbo Lane near the station entrance.
It's worth noting that there is no provision for bicycle hire directly at the station, although cyclists are still embraced with nearby facilities and services that encourage pedal-powered travel.
